**PEOPLE DATA ANALYST - SYSTEMS & ADMINISTRATION**

At The Star Entertainment Group, we aim to be Australia's leading integrated resort company. Our mission is to create fun and memorable experiences for the millions of guests we welcome each year at our trusted destinations.

Our properties across Sydney, Brisbane, and the Gold Coast are world-class with many award-winning hotels, restaurants, bars, and entertainment venues.

The Star Entertainment Group (TSEG) is an ASX-listed company committed to supporting the communities in which we operate. TSEG will achieve this by leading with integrity and values to enable us to provide entertainment, gaming, and leisure experiences safely, responsibly, and ethically.

As our People Data Analyst, reporting to the Group Manager People Systems & Reporting, you'll be responsible for executing key initiatives including collecting and interpreting complex data sets to identify patterns, trends and insights for data-driven decisions related to People and Performance (P&P).

This is a fantastic opportunity for an individual who thrives in data analysis and has knowledge on people-related functions. Through governing HR audit models and accurately reporting data, you will support The Star in achieving wage compliance.

This is a 6-month full-time contract opportunity

**A few of your responsibilities**
- Ensure accurate maintenance of employee information, including establishing ongoing auditing systems.
- Manage the process for bulk uploads into the system, ensuring governance is adhered to and all testing is completed prior to uploads occurring in production.
- Build audit models on HR data, particularly, wage compliance, and ensure all your HR project data is effectively governed and accurately obtained.
- Ensure compliance with The Star Entertainment Group's policies and any relevant legislation and statutory requirements.
- Act as the Data Custodian to ensure downstream impacts are monitored and understood across the team.
- Provide support for information retrieval from systems by generating standard reports that will support data analysis.

**What we are looking for**
- Demonstrated experience in data analysis, statistical modeling and data mining.
- Strong ability to gather and document requirements in line with governance.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with attention to accuracy.
- Ability to communicate and present reporting data to senior stakeholders and external vendors.
- Knowledge/exposure to HR/people-related functions advantageous.

You are a seasoned Data Analyst who is an expert in documenting processes and procedures, always seeking to optimise and improve ways of working. You excel in high-volume data and have great written communication skills to articulate processes and data models.

Your role will be pivotal in shaping the success of data governance and BAU wage compliance processes within People & Performance.
